Quotes by Tippi Hedren

“I use every single thing that Alfred Hitchcock taught me in my acting career... I am very grateful for the education he gave me in making motion pictures.”

“Honest to God, all my life I have had such a fear of spiders. In fact, I use to have a reoccurring dream about one. Very clearly, it was black with a red head. It would sit up in the corner of the bedroom and when it started getting closer, I would wake up in a panic.”

“Hitchcock had a charm about him. He was very funny at times. He was incredibly brilliant in his field of suspense.”

“One lion thinks it's just hilarious to tackle us. He's very funny about it... and we always know when it will happen.”

“Working with Chaplin was very amusing and strange. His films are so funny, but working with him, I found him to be a very serious man. Whereas the films of Hitchcock are macabre, he could be a very funny man to work with, always telling jokes and holding court. Of course, when I worked with Charlie he was getting older.”

“So I think it is common knowledge that Hitchcock had fantasies or whatever you want to call them about his leading ladies.”

“I was at the end of the studio system so when I walked into movies, I had a magnificent suite in which I had a living room and a kitchen and a complete makeup room. I had everything just for me. With the independents, you're kind of roughing it, literally.”

“I could really use a corporate sponsor. People think that because you're in the movies, you're rich. I have allocated all my resources to Shambala so the animals will always be safe.”

“So I do have to work, you know, and I find as many movies and TV shows that I can, because otherwise I wouldn't have an income.”
